Top definition
One of two French teachers at Jeffersonville High. Known for being a total bitch, is often made fun of for her accent and her ackwardness. Is despised by damn near all of her students. Her main least favorite student is a girl in her fifth period class, one of two who coined the nickname "Frenchie."
We predict this name will likely stick for as long as she stays at Jeff......
Person: Damn Madame Johnson is such a bitch.
Friend: I know right! She's always making fun of me. I cant wait to get Felix next year.
Person: Me too.
by ThatCriminalMastermind March 30, 2012
Get the mug
Get a Madame Johnson mug for your dad Vivek.